1.8 Interesting Facts
  • Portuguese language has absorbed many words from French, Italian, Arabic and also from indigenous South American and African languages.
  • The first written document in Portuguese language was found in the 12th century.
  • There is unique pronunciation system in the Madurese language.
  • Madurese was first written using Javanese Alphabets.
